 /* Первый слайдер — на всю ширину */
.slider-full {
  width: 100%;
  margin-bottom: 40px;
}
.slider-full .swiper-slide {
  height: 100%;
  display: flex;
  justify-content: center;
  align-items: center;
  background: #fff;
  font-size: 24px;
  color: #333;
}

/* Второй слайдер — карусель с 200px слайдами */
.slider-carousel {
  width: 100%;
}

.slider-carousel .swiper-slide {
  width: 200px;
  background: #fff;
  color: black;
  font-size: 14px;
  text-align: left;
  padding: 0px;
  box-sizing: border-box;
}

/* Блок с картинкой — фиксированная высота */
.slider-carousel .slide-image {
  width: 200px;
  overflow: hidden;
  margin-bottom: 0px;
}

.slider-carousel .slide-image img {
    width: 100%;
    height: 100%;
  object-fit: cover; /* или 'contain', если важно не обрезать */
  display: block;
}

/* Скрываем стрелки */
.slider-carousel .swiper-button-next,
.slider-carousel .swiper-button-prev {
  opacity: 0;
  transition: opacity 0.25s ease;
  /* Убедимся, что они не мешают при скрытом состоянии */
  pointer-events: none;
}

.slider-carousel:hover .swiper-button-next,
.slider-carousel:hover .swiper-button-prev {
  opacity: 1;
  pointer-events: auto;
}
